Friend-Invitation Promotion Scheme Used in Electric Carsharing: Empirical Analysis and Policy Implications

Table 1

Null hypotheses were used in the data analysis and their respective tests.

S/NContentsTests

1Ages in the samples of the new and old members originate from the same distributionOne-way ANOVA on ranks
2The median age of the new members is not greater than that of the old membersMann–Whitney Wilcoxon test
3The median number of successful friend invitations of the old scheme participants is not greater than that of the new scheme participantsMann–Whitney Wilcoxon test
4The median number of successful friend invitations per month of the new scheme participants is not greater than that of the old scheme participantsMann–Whitney Wilcoxon test
5The number of friend invitations in the samples of the new scheme participants who were invited by friends to register as a member and the other new scheme participants originates from the same distributionOne-way ANOVA on ranks
6The median number of friend invitations of the new scheme participants who were invited by friends to register as a member is not equal to that of the other new scheme participantsMann–Whitney Wilcoxon test
7The median age of the not-invited new members is not greater than that of the invited new membersMann–Whitney Wilcoxon test
8The median age of the scheme participants is not less than that of the other membersMann–Whitney Wilcoxon test
